Best Charcoal Grill: Your Ultimate Buying Guide

Grill size and cooking area

The amount of food you can cook simultaneously is perhaps the most critical consideration for any outdoor cooking appliance.

This cooking surface dictates whether you’ll be flipping burgers for a small family or hosting a neighborhood barbecue. For individuals or couples, compact units with a modest grilling expanse are ideal, fitting comfortably on apartment balconies or smaller patios without overwhelming the space. However, for those who frequently entertain guests or have larger families, a substantial cooking area becomes essential, allowing you to prepare multiple dishes or large cuts of meat efficiently.

When evaluating models, pay close attention to the grate dimensions—width and depth—and how this translates to the overall footprint of the unit. A larger surface area means more versatility, enabling the simultaneous cooking of steaks, vegetables, and even whole chickens, transforming your backyard into a culinary hub for gatherings.

Always visualize your typical cooking needs to ensure the capacity meets your lifestyle.

Material and construction for durability

The foundation of a long-lasting and reliable cooking companion lies in its material composition and build quality.

A grill built with robust materials will not only withstand the rigors of frequent outdoor use but also contribute significantly to its performance and longevity, ensuring consistent results for years of barbecues and gatherings.

Pay close attention to the primary metals used, such as the corrosion-resistant and easy-to-clean nature of porcelain-enameled steel, the premium durability and flavor-enhancing properties of cast iron, or the sleek, weather-resistant appeal of stainless steel. The thickness of the lid and body is paramount, as it dictates heat retention, creating a more stable cooking environment and allowing for better temperature management, crucial for searing steaks or slow-cooking ribs. Inspect features that protect against the elements; excellent rust resistance and robust weatherproofing ensure your grill remains in prime condition season after season.

Furthermore, the lid hinge mechanism should be sturdy and well-engineered, with smooth operation and a secure fit to prevent heat loss and accommodate easy access during cooking. These elements collectively determine a grill’s resilience and its ability to deliver exceptional culinary experiences.

Temperature management and airflow

Mastering the heat is fundamental to achieving culinary perfection on a cooker fueled by embers.

The ability to manage and regulate temperature is paramount to unlocking the full potential of direct and indirect cooking methods. This control is primarily achieved through meticulously designed ventilation systems. Effective airflow management not only dictates the intensity of your flame but also influences the overall cooking time and the juiciness of your food.

Look for models featuring adjustable top and bottom vents; these elements work in tandem to starve the fire of oxygen for lower temperatures or to provide ample fuel for roaring heat. For instance, fully open bottom vents coupled with a partially open top vent create a strong draft, ideal for reaching the high temperatures needed for a satisfying sear on steaks.

Built-in thermometers offer a convenient, at-a-glance measure of the internal environment, allowing for proactive adjustments rather than reactive guesswork. This dual approach—manual vent manipulation and thermometer monitoring—empowers you to target specific heat zones, from a blistering 500°F for searing to a gentle 225°F for delicate smoking.

Ignition and startup features

Achieving perfectly lit coals quickly and efficiently is paramount to a successful grilling session.

This aspect directly influences how soon you can start cooking and the overall enjoyment of your outdoor culinary experience. Frustration with slow or uneven lighting can derail even the most well-planned cookout, so understanding the ignition and startup mechanisms of a grill is vital for a seamless experience.

Consider the various methods available to get your briquettes or lump charcoal glowing. Many enthusiasts prefer the speed and reliability of a charcoal chimney starter, which uses a simpler airflow principle for faster lighting compared to mounding coals directly on the grates.

While lighter fluid provides a quick start, purists often opt for natural lighting methods, focusing on airflow and patience, though this can sometimes lead to troubleshooting challenges like uneven burning or difficulty igniting. Evaluating these ignition features ensures you’ll spend less time waiting and more time savoring your delicious grilled creations.

What Is The Best Way To Maintain And Clean A Charcoal Grill For Longevity?

To maximize your charcoal grill’s lifespan, regularly scrape grates clean while warm and empty ash after each use to prevent corrosion. Periodically, deep clean the interior and exterior with mild soap and water, ensuring all parts are dry before reassembly or storage.
